A Juridical Study of the Rehabilitation Judgment Assessment for Narcotics Abuse

Agus Darwanta | Handoyo Prasetyo [2]


Abstract: Narcotics Law No. 35 of 2009 addresses narcotics abuse and illicit narcotic drug trafficking. This law adheres to a double-track system in the form of criminal and action sanctions. In court decisions, there can be differences regarding criminal or sanctions actions. This study was subjected to analysis of several rehabilitation decisions for narcotic abuse. Based on assessments from the Integrated Assessment Team, the results of the analysis of the criminal verdicts for rehabilitation in narcotics abuse cases are still diverse and varied. Efforts to fulfil rehabilitation rights for narcotics addicts during the trial process are assessments from the Integrated Assessment Team that state that the accused requires rehabilitation, according to Law No. 35 of 2009. The assessment results should be the basis of the judge's decision in fulfilling rehabilitation rights for narcotics addicts while remaining guided by juridical elements, philosophical elements, and sociological elements.
